Build failed with

| In file included from libc/misc/regex/regex.c:59:
| libc/misc/regex/regexec.c:315: error: conflicting types for 're_search_2_stub'
| libc/misc/regex/regexec.c:44: note: previous declaration of 're_search_2_stub' was here
| libc/misc/regex/regexec.c:358: error: conflicting types for 're_search_stub'
| libc/misc/regex/regexec.c:49: note: previous declaration of 're_search_stub' was here
.... etc
